Help my mom pick a new car
So my mom's husband has epilepsy and flipped her mazda 3 with her in it when he had a seizure so she needs to get a new car.
She's trying to stay around 17-20k for a car but would consider going a little bit over. She puts 20-25k on her car yearly as she travels a little for her job.
She's looking at Toyota Corolla S or Hyundai Elantra. Both auto. I told her to consider Mitsubishi Lancer. She doesn't want another mazda. Which car do you think she should buy or are there any others you would recommend?
